  6. My best advice would be to get a wig now especially if your hair is prone to thinning or breakage . I have a great wig that I have been wearing for the last two weeks. I was trying to grow out my hair as it's in an awkward in between stage but also I wanted something to hide the hair loss when it does happen after my surgery on the 4th . I can now rest easy knowing that I will not have to worry about when and how bad my hair will thin. I've also been taking biotin religiously for about the last two years and I'm hoping it will help. I lost my hair after childbirth and due to chemical relaxers at least three times in the past so I'm not overly concerned about it but I have been growing my hair out ( African American natural hair) with such care for the last 15 months I really want to keep as much as I can.
  7. Mine has been rough. A Protein shake for 2 meals and then 4 ounces of protein and a half cup of green vegetables for the third meal. No starches . Two servings of broth, sugar free popsicles, and sugar free Jello as needed to help with hunger which don't help all that much. However, this time next week I'll be post-op. Trying my best to hang in there
